    Just had my first service at Forecast, and it was amazing! I was a little wary going to a salon since COVID-19, but the amount of care and thought the salon is putting towards being safe is truly impressive. Guests wait in their cars until their stylist is ready, my emperature was checked on arrival, all guests must wash their hands/sanitize phones on arrival, stations were spaced out, and employees and guests were all wearing masks and using hand sanitizer around the clock. They are sanitizing every surface in the salon every 90 minutes and have an air scrubber to reduce contamination in the air. I felt very reassured and safe getting a hair service at Forecast. The interior decor is very modern and relaxing, and I love that the owner's friendly dog was at the salon as well. They also offer alcoholic/non-alcoholic drinks which I will definitely enjoy at my next service, but I held off so that I could keep my mask on the entire time given that I work in healthcare and have had some recent COVID-19 exposures. Alicia gave me a perfect haircut (just a trim with long layers) all while being sweet, bubbly and a friendly face to talk to. She gave the best head massage with my shampoo. It seems like she is new to working part-time at Forecast, but has been working in hair for over 10 years and works full-time for a hair product company providing education on hair & coloring-- she seemed like a true pro, and I would definitely recommend her! I will for sure be back to try out their color services.
